Abstract

Direct numerical simulation of a simple reaction between two scalars in a plane turbulent wall jet has been performed. In addition to mean and fluctuation intensities also higher order statistics and the probability density functions of the reacting scalars have been examined. The probability density functions shed light on the behavior of the passive and reacting scalars close to the wall and also to the near-wall characteristics of the reaction.
